I remember the time when I took a young and inexperienced Saints Rugby team to face off against Bath Rugby at the Rec in 1988. We started off strong, leading 3-0 in the beginning. However, despite our best efforts, we eventually succumbed to Bath’s superior skill and experience, with the final score standing at 52-3. It was a humbling experience, but one that taught us invaluable lessons about the level of competition in the rugby world.
